I don’t have time for a write-up now; however, this is a heads up that STP has once again fallen to bargain basement prices. The Fusion Investing Portfolio plans to buy 2,000 shares on Friday 3 October.
You can check my previous articles on Suntech here.
The good: PEG of 0.53, forward P/E of 11.66, dominant low cost solar provider, good margins and return on equity, excellent R&D.
The bad: High debt, earnings not translating to cash flow due to investments in growth.

Suntech Power Holdings Co. Ltd. (STP)
Suntech Reports Second Quarter 2008 Financial Results
Great results shouldn’t be a surprise to anyone. I’ll write more tomorrow, but from my first look it was a sensational quarter.

Expectations were for $0.32 (.27-.27 range) STP did $0.41 up from $0.25 last year. (GAAP $0.38)
Revenue grew 51.3% to $480.2 million comfortably ahead of the May forecast of $430 million to $440 million. Expectations were for $439M.
